The Origins of Casino Gaming Technology

The roots of casino gaming technology can be traced back to the late 19th century when the first mechanical slot machines were introduced. These machines, known as “one-armed bandits,” featured simple reels and a lever that players would pull to spin. Over the decades, these mechanical devices evolved into electronic versions, paving the way for the modern gaming experience. Technological advancements allowed for increased complexity and the introduction of more sophisticated game designs.

As slot machines gained popularity, other casino games also began adopting technological innovations. The introduction of video poker and electronic table games marked significant milestones in the casino world. Players were drawn to the interactive experience, creating a new dynamic in how games were played, especially in large casino establishments. The Digital Revolution in Casinos

The late 20th century witnessed a digital revolution that reshaped casino gaming significantly. With the advent of the Internet, online casinos emerged, allowing players to indulge in their favorite games from the comfort of their homes. This shift democratized access to gaming, removing geographical restrictions that were once barriers to entry. Players could now wager on a variety of games, including slots, blackjack, and roulette, without stepping into a physical casino.

Moreover, mobile technology further catalyzed this evolution, making casino gaming even more accessible. Smartphones equipped with specialized apps allowed users to engage in gaming experiences anywhere and anytime. This progression reinforced the bond between technology and convenience, ushering in a new era in which players demanded engaging graphics, instant play, and seamless connectivity. The user-friendly interfaces of these apps have opened gaming to a younger and more diverse audience, expanding the market potential significantly.

Current Trends in Casino Gaming Technology

Today, the landscape of casino gaming technology is characterized by several emerging trends. One notable advancement is the utilization of vir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R) technologies. Casinos are increasingly adopting VR environments to create immersive gaming experiences that transport players into lifelike, interactive worlds. This innovation not only enhances the thrill of gaming but also opens up new avenues for social interaction among players.

Artificial intelligence (AI) is another critical player in the evolution of casino gaming. AI technologies are being used to personalize player experiences, analyze gambling patterns, and provide tailored recommendations. This not only enhances user satisfaction but also helps casinos to optimize their offerings and strategies, resulting in a more engaging and enjoyable customer experience. By harnessing the power of data, casinos can curate games that align with individual preferences, creating a more tailored and enjoyable environment for players.

Furthermore, gamification is becoming increasingly prevalent, as casinos incorporate elements from video games to enhance user engagement. Features such as achievements, leaderboards, and rewards can incentivize players to explore different areas of the casino, thereby increasing their overall time spent gaming. This trend reflects the broader cultural shifts toward interactive and engaging entertainment, which resonates with various demographic groups.

The Future of Casino Gaming Technology

Looking ahead, the future of casino gaming technology is brimming with potential. With advancements in blockchain and cryptocurrency, casinos may soon offer decentralized gaming options, enhancing security and transparency. As cryptocurrencies gain mainstream acceptance, the adoption of this payment method could redefine transactions within the gaming industry, providing players with more options for engaging with casinos.

Furthermore, loyalty programs integrated with AI could enrich the player experience by providing customized rewards based on player behavior and preferences. This personalized approach is likely to become standard practice, ensuring that players feel valued and connected to their gaming experiences, ultimately driving loyalty and retention for casinos. The integration of social aspects in gaming experiences can also lead to enhanced community building among players, as they connect over shared gaming experiences.

Developments in responsible gaming technology will also play a pivotal role in the future of casino gaming. Innovative software solutions can track player behavior and help identify those at risk of gambling-related issues, ensuring that the industry evolves in a manner that prioritizes player health and safety.
